1
Lacerte Tax logo

Lacerte Tax

pro tax suite

Runs tax preparation workflows for S corporations with advanced form support, worksheet logic, and tax research inside Intuit ProConnect tax software.

Overall Rating9.3/10
Features
9.4/10
Ease of Use
8.6/10
Value
8.7/10
Standout Feature

Built-in S corporation shareholder basis tracking linked through Form 1120-S

Lacerte Tax from Intuit stands out for its deep, tax-law-aligned support for business filings and its tight workflow integration with Intuit tax products. It delivers S corporation-specific preparation for Form 1120-S, including shareholder basis and income flows tied to the return. The software includes robust diagnostics and error checks that help catch common preparation issues before filing. It also supports returns with multiple states, which matters for S corps with nonresident or multistate activity.

Pros

  • Strong S corporation return support with Form 1120-S workflow
  • Shareholder basis and distribution handling built into preparation
  • High-quality diagnostic checks that reduce filing mistakes
  • Multistate preparation support for returns with state allocations
  • Integrates cleanly with other Intuit tax workflows

Cons

  • Advanced interview screens can feel heavy for simple S corps
  • Setup time is higher for firms with inconsistent prior-year formats
  • Cost adds up quickly for small offices with few returns

Best For

Tax firms running frequent S corp filings with complex multistate needs

What Is S Corp Tax Software?

S Corp tax software prepares pass-through business filings that generate Form 1120-S and shareholder reporting figures tied to Schedule K-1. These products reduce missed inputs through structured interview screens, diagnostics, and return review workflows. S Corp tax software is typically used by tax offices that must repeat compliance steps across clients and states, or by accounting teams that need tax-ready reporting from the books. In practice, Lacerte Tax focuses on Form 1120-S workflow depth with built-in shareholder basis tracking, while Drake Tax focuses on office workflow reuse across successive S Corp filings.
